Key Investor Types: TNXP's investor base is composed of a mix of retail investors, institutional investors, and potentially hedge funds. Each group brings different investment strategies and motivations.
- Retail Investors: These individual investors often have varying levels of financial knowledge and risk tolerance. Their investment decisions may be influenced by news, social media, and personal beliefs about the company's potential.
- Institutional Investors: These include mutual funds, pension funds, and insurance companies that manage large sums of money on behalf of others. They typically conduct thorough research and analysis before investing, focusing on long-term growth and stability.
- Hedge Funds: These are investment partnerships that use more aggressive strategies, such as short-selling and leveraging, to generate higher returns. Their investment horizons can be shorter, and their decisions are often driven by specific market opportunities.

Tracking Investor Moves:
Information on significant investor transactions is typically disclosed in regulatory filings, such as Form 4 (for insider transactions) and Schedule 13D/G (for investors owning more than 5% of a company's shares). Monitoring these filings can provide insights into the sentiment and actions of key investors.
